Slot Machines
Is it an acquired skill or a program controlled game?
How To Play
1. A player begins a new game by inserting a coin in a slot machine. They then pull the machines handle down or hit the 'spin' button.
2. Three random numbers are selected by the machine and shown on its display reel. These numbers are chosen from a random number generator that is constantly drawing random numbers at a rate of thousands per second. The first numbers chosen, from a new players’ first game are the ones used to determine the final outcome. In other words the outcome is predestined the moment the player spins the reels.
3. The random firtst three random numbers chosen from the previous step will usually be very large, very small is also a possibility. These numbers will be converted to a desired range, for example integers from 0 to 63. An easy way this can be done is to divide the large number by the desired number and take the remainder.
4. The small random numbers will go through a mapping table to be assigned a specific reel to stop on. Each possible random number on each reel is mapped to a specific stop. Generally the higher paying symbols are mapped to fewer numbers.
5. As soon as machine has started its first spin, it has determined where the reels are going to stop! The machine then lets the reels spin a few seconds for players’ entertainment before stopping at its pre-programmed destination.
